Common Problems: TESLA MODEL S
Known issues reported by owners and MOT testers.
- MCU1 eMMC Memory Failure (Recall 21V035)(Moderate)
The main touchscreen unit (MCU1) uses an 8GB eMMC chip that has a finite lifespan, eventually leading to system instability or total failure. Tesla issued a voluntary recall (21V035) to upgrade the chip to 64GB.
- Suspension Control Arm Creaking(Moderate)
The front and rear suspension control arms (wishbones) can develop a loud creaking or squeaking noise, particularly when turning or going over bumps, caused by water ingress into the ball joints.
- Air Suspension Leaks(Moderate)
The air suspension struts or compressor can fail, causing the car to sag or display suspension fault messages.
